[quote=Anonymous]Not everyone getting school paid for is a diplomat. Even if they are, overseas postings are commonly for three years so kids have to be able to go assimilate back into their own country's schools upon return. Privates can make that easier depending on the country of origin. Growing up my dad's company paid for us to attend a private school when posted overseas. In our experience it was for the language-barrier. There's no way we could go to a public school starting in middle school not speak the language at all and have an easy transition. The are American schools in Japan, London, Switzerland, etc. that American companies regularly pay for. And in our case as expats, we paid tax overseas and in America. [/quote]
